Home foundation repair services focus on diagnosing and addressing issues related to the structural support of a property’s foundation. These services typically involve evaluating the extent of foundation settlement, cracks, or shifting, and implementing appropriate solutions such as underpinning, piering, or stabilization techniques. The goal is to restore the foundation’s integrity, ensuring the stability and safety of the entire structure. Professionals may utilize specialized equipment and methods to assess the condition of the foundation before recommending the most suitable repair options.

Foundation problems often manifest as vis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that no longer open properly. Left unaddressed, these issues can lead to further structural damage, increased repair costs, and potential safety hazards. Repair services help mitigate these risks by correcting foundation movement or settling, preventing further deterioration. Addressing foundation concerns early can also help preserve the value of a property and avoid more extensive and costly repairs in the future.

These services are commonly utilized for residential properties, including single-family homes, townhouses, and duplexes, particularly those situated on uneven or expansive soils. Commercial buildings and multi-unit complexes may also require foundation repair when signs of shifting or settling appear. Properties in regions prone to so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or seismic activity often benefit from proactive foundation assessments and repairs to maintain structural stability over time.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ation repair services ranges from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of the damage. For example, minor crack repairs may cost around $2,000, while extensive underpinning can reach higher amounts. Variations are common based on the specific needs of each property.

Pier and Beam Repair Expenses - Repairs for pier and beam foundations generally fall between $1,500 and $4,500. Smaller repairs, such as fixing or replacing piers, tend to be on the lower end, while more comprehensive stabilization can increase costs. Actual prices depend on the size and condition of the foundation.

Cost Factors - The total cost of foundation repair services can vary significantly based on factors like soil conditions, foundation size, and the repair method used. Additional work, such as drainage improvements or soil stabilization, may add to the overall expense.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ific property needs.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Signs can include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around window or door frames.

How can foundation problems affect a home? Foundation issues may lead to structural instability, increased repair costs, and potential safety hazards if left unaddressed.

What types of foundation repair services are available? Local service providers typically offer methods such as slabjacking, pier and beam repair, crack repair, and waterproofing to address various foundation concerns.

How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age and the chosen repair method, with some projects completing within a few days to a few weeks.
